Dunderheaded
adj ·Moderate ·College level
Definitions
- 1 Stupid, foolish.
"Much nearer sixty years of age than fifty, with a flowing outline of stomach, and horizontal creases in his waistcoat; reputed to be rich; voting at elections in the strictly respectable interest; morally satisfied that nothing but he himself has grown since he was a baby; how can dunder-headed Mr. Sapsea be otherwise than a credit to Cloisterham, and society?"

Etymology
From dunder + headed.
